Buying in the EU

If you buy online within the EU, Iceland or Norway, you have strong consumer rights, particularly if something goes wrong. In this section you can find out when you can cancel an order and get a refund, what to do if your delivery is late or doesn’t arrive and how to deal with a poor service experience. We also provide letter templates to help you resolve any issues.
